# Voice-Powered DeFi - FOMO Radio AI X SEND AI

The integration of SEND AI with FOMO Radio AI enhances the ecosystem by introducing advanced conversational capabilities and on-chain functionalities, including DeFAI-powered interactions. This partnership unlocks groundbreaking possibilities for voice-driven engagement and blockchain-enabled transactions.

#### <mark style="color:purple;">**Key Features of the Integration**</mark>

1. **Voice-Activated On-Chain Transactions:**\
   Perform blockchain operations effortlessly using intuitive voice commands. Supported actions include:
   * Token swaps
   * Balance checks
   * Staking
   * Solana-based operations
2. **Seamless User Experience:**
   * Process user requests intuitively
   * Verify transaction details with precision
   * Execute secure and efficient transactions—all within a smooth conversational flow
3. **Advanced Interactivity:**\
   Users can transition seamlessly from consuming content to performing blockchain operations, redefining what’s possible in Web3 engagement.

#### <mark style="color:purple;">**More Than Just Voice Commands**</mark>

SEND AI elevates voice-driven interactivity beyond basic commands.

1. **Beyond Basic Transactions**\
   Perform complex workflows with ease, such as:
   * **Bridging assets:** “Bridge 1000 USDC from Solana to Ethereum and stake it on Aave.”
   * **Automated optimization:** Transactions are optimized for speed and fees, saving time and effort compared to manual processes.
2. **Contextual Insights**\
   Get real-time suggestions and alerts, such as:
   * **“Gas fees on Ethereum are high; want to switch to Polygon?”**
   * **“This smart contract hasn’t been audited. Proceed with caution.”**
